Website. alpa .org. The Air Line Pilots Association, International ( ALPA) is the largest pilot union in the world, [ 1] representing more than 77,000 pilots [ 1] from 43 US and Canadian airlines. ALPA was founded on 27 July 1931 [ 2][ 3] and is a member of the AFL-CIO and the Canadian Labour Congress. Known internationally as US-ALPA, ALPA is ...
The Aircraft Owners and Pilots Association ( AOPA) is a Frederick, Maryland -based American non-profit political organization that advocates for general aviation. AOPA's membership consists mainly of general aviation pilots in the United States. [2] [3] AOPA exists to serve the interests of its members as aircraft owners and pilots and to ...
Board of Pilot Commissioners for the Bays of San Francisco, San Pablo, and Suisun is the California state agency responsible for licensing and regulating pilots within one of the largest harbors in the world and the tributary Sacramento River delta. It licenses and regulates up to 60 pilots of the San Francisco Bar Pilots Association. [1]
At a meeting in London in April 1948 a conference of pilot associations was held that formed the International Federation of Air Line Pilots' Associations. IFALPA was located in the UK from 1948 to 2012. In 2012 the Federation established its headquarters in Montreal, Canada, the World Capital of Civil Aviation, and is located near ICAO.

In 1945, test pilot James M. Nissen and two partners leased about 16 acres (6.5 ha) of this land to build a runway, hangar and office building for a flight school. When the city of San Jose decided to develop a municipal airport, Nissen sold his share of the aviation business and became San Jose's first airport manager.
